Pure water is described as neutral because it has a pH level of 7 at 25 degrees Celsius (77 degrees Fahrenheit). The pH scale ranges from 0 to 14, where a pH less than 7 is considered acidic, a pH of 7 is neutral, and a pH greater than 7 is considered basic or alkaline. This neutrality is due to the equal concentration of hydrogen ions (H⁺) and hydroxide ions (OH⁻) present in pure water. This balance is essential as it provides a stable environment for chemical reactions and biological processes in living organisms.

When water is pure, it does not contain additional solutes that could affect its pH level, which is why it is a critical reference point in various scientific fields, including biology and chemistry. The significance of this neutrality is particularly relevant in biological systems where enzymes and metabolic processes often require specific pH levels to function optimally.
